Description Hiring Tool is a modern applicant tracking system (ATS) specifically designed for startups and small to medium-sized enterprises (SMEs). It centralizes and streamlines the entire hiring process, from creating and distributing job postings to managing offers, enhancing efficiency and improving the overall candidate experience. This platform aims to simplify recruitment workflows, foster team collaboration, and provide valuable insights into hiring performance for growing businesses. HubbleIQ is an AI-powered Digital Employee Experience (DEX) monitoring platform designed to proactively identify, diagnose, and resolve end-user technology issues. It provides comprehensive visibility into device health, application performance, and network connectivity, leveraging artificial intelligence to perform root cause analysis and automate remediation. This solution empowers IT teams to shift from reactive troubleshooting to proactive problem-solving, significantly enhancing employee productivity and satisfaction by ensuring a reliable digital work environment.
What It Does Hiring Tool serves as a comprehensive platform that centralizes all aspects of recruitment. It enables users to create branded career pages, publish job openings to various boards, manage candidate applications through custom pipelines, and facilitate communication with applicants. The system also supports team collaboration, interview scheduling, and the creation and tracking of job offers. HubbleIQ continuously monitors the entire digital employee journey, collecting vast amounts of telemetry data from endpoints, applications, and networks. Its AI engine then processes this data to automatically detect anomalies, pinpoint the exact root cause of issues, and initiate automated remediation actions or provide guided solutions to IT support. This proactive approach minimizes downtime and reduces the burden on help desks.
